Covariant form of the ponderomotive potentials in a magnetized plasma

  • 1. Institute of Plasma Physics, Nagoya University, Nagoya 464, Japan

Description

With use of the Lie transform technique, a simple and compact but quite general expression is derived for the ponderomotive scalar and vector potentials phi-bar and A in the covariant form (A,iphi-bar)=A-bar/sub μ/=-1/2. The four-vector zeta/sub ν/ is the particle excursion in four-dimensional space due to the rf electric and magnetic fields, F/sub munu/ is the high-frequency electromagnetic tensor, and the brackets denote an average over the high-frequency phase kxx-ωt
